Position Summary

The Automation Engineer is a key member of the Electrolyzer engineering team and requires close interaction with the cross-discipline engineering, delivery, manufacturing, commissioning and service support teams. In this position the individual is responsible for the design, integration and testing of Package Controllers and Integrated Control & Safety systems of Plug’s hydrogen generation systems. By combining strong troubleshooting skills, quality focus, and collaboration with cross-functional teams, the Automation Engineer ensures system robustness, user satisfaction, and continuous improvement of the existing control and safety systems. The successful candidate must be self-motivated, able to handle multiple assignments and willing to learn and adapt in a fast-paced engineering organization.

Core Duties and Responsibilities

Responsible for technical design of Plug’s automation & control systems e.g. package control systems (PLC), Distributed Control & Safety Systems (DCS/ESD) and integrated control & safety systems (ICSS)

Develop basis of design and control system architectures for automation system and subsystem of next generation hydrogen generation systems considering cost reductions and reliability improvements

Ensure that interfaces with other engineering disciplines (e.g. process, instrumentation, functional safety and electrical) are consistent and aligned

Responsible for handling technical communication with external engineering parties, suppliers and where applicable to clients

Review documents prepared by sub-contractors to ensure quality and consistency

Provide support during the conceptual and basic design phase and help estimating costs of the project (hours, equipment and construction budgets)

Create system and subsystem specification/automation philosophy for procurement of automation systems

Assist in developing a project specific system design with all associated documentation (philosophies, layouts, specifications, block diagrams, Cause & Effect diagrams, etc.)

Ensure functional safety software/application design, development, testing, operation and maintenance will be in accordance with the IEC 61508 standards

Ensure cybersecurity requirements are embedded during system design and with secure access controls across PLC, SCADA and DCS environments

Participate in technical review meetings (P&ID review / HAZOP / SIL / LOPA / etc.)

Identify issues (problems, value improvement opportunities) and help clarify areas of complexity during all phases of the engineering design work

Provide frontline support for control system faults and subsystem communications issues on Electrolyzer systems in operation

Perform diagnostic and failure analysis on PLC/DCS-based systems

Assist in developing Functional Safety Management processes / procedures / instructions related to control systems

Assist in developing and implementation in an organization-wide IACS cybersecurity management system in line with the IEC 62443 standards

Is well-versed with (International) Codes & Standards, e.g. CE, IEC, ATEX, and ensures that designs comply with applicable codes & standards/legislation

Developing knowledge and skills to be able to address current and future project needs

Stay informed on the latest developments in industrial automation and IIoT/Edge solutions, OT cybersecurity and relevant codes & standards and ensure these developments are integrated into Plug’s control system designs and practices.

Proactively communicate technical risks, challenges, and scope changes to the Engineering Manager and escalate critical issues as needed to ensure timely resolution

Responsible for growing Automation knowledge & expertise within the team

Mentor team members on design work and act as senior technical resource for guidance

Always Represent Plug Power in a professional manner and in all interactions

Perform all other duties as assigned

Education and Experience

Bachelor's or Master's degree in industrial automation and relevant work experience

Has at least 10 years of experience as Automation engineer, preferably in renewable energy sector and/or product manufacturing and testing environment

Experience with Control System Hardware and Specification – I/O modules, ESD/SIS, BPCS, package control systems (PLC), Architecture Design, etc.

Knowledge and experience with various Package controllers (e.g. Siemens S7-1500, Schneider Electric M580, etc.) and SCADA-HMI systems

Knowledge and experience with various DCS based controllers (e.g. Emerson DeltaV, ABB 800xA, Honeywell Experion C300, Siemens PCS7, etc.)

Knowledge and experience with Functional Safety according to IEC 61511 or IEC 61508. Having a functional safety/machine safety certificate is a plus

Certified or proven expertise in OT cybersecurity and industrial networking for PLC/DCS/SCADA environments, with practical application of IEC 62443, and related standards (e.g. ISA/IEC 62443 Certificates, GICSP, TÜV programs), including deep knowledge of network architectures, segmentation, and industrial communication protocols (e.g. Profinet, Modbus, OPC UA, Ethernet/IP)

Possess solid hands-on approach to problem-solving and with ability to debug and troubleshoot automation control systems

Computer and software systems skills including but not limited to: Word, PowerPoint, Excel, and Outlook

Must be capable of working independently, in a fast-paced environment, with minimal supervision.

Sound organizational skills for completing tasks as scheduled

Strong communication skills both verbal and written for the purpose of explaining challenges and solutions internally

Good interpersonal skills to successfully interface other engineering disciplines and customers
